First post to say how impressed I am with this game now

With this new patch I'm getting great performance with graphics set to high. This is easily the best looking game I've ever seen and the fps I'm getting for how good it looks is really impressive. The ability to look and move about the cockpit with the mouse is really immerse compared to il2 1946. I found myself taking a hurricane up to high altitude with the engine starting to labour and cut with the advanced engine modelling. After spending a while setting keys and operating pitch and mix with ctrl + throttle and shift + throttle, I was looking at the exhaust colour and trying to get the best mix - so immerse.

I burnt damaged the exhaust a bit after messing up coming back down ;) Landed slightly hairily and watched the trees and grass blowing in the wind.

A combat engagement near the cost with about 10 planes ran the same - really well.
Over London I get slightly lower frames at low altitude - but still felt like a fightable fps. I'm not getting the big variation and jumps at all.

I'm getting at least 30-40 fps and often more. Stuttering is mild

I am starting to find this all getting a little irritating. Nothing seems consistant at the moment. I am not even sure if the patch has downloaded and installed. I can see no version number on any of my screens. Something downloaded and my axis controls were suddenly changed around so I can only assume it has.
The frame rate dropped drastically and the more I reduced the video settings the worse it got until eventually flying the quick mission over Dover with just the Hurrican and everything set on minimum I was down to 10fps. So I just wacked everything up to maximum and the fps immediately jumped to 40! Until I got close to the ground when the fps evaporated again.
The things that gave me better fps on the deck were turning off grass, setting buidings amount to high and buildings detail to very low. Even with forest on very high I am getting 30fps down low but the biggest factor was turning AA down to 2x. And the landscape looks pretty good.
When I checked the performance I found the CPU Usage was only about 14% until I changed the affinity mask to 15 when the usage doubled to 30%.
I still don't think things are as good when multiple aircraft are around with even more stuttering than pre patch. I think it's just a case of experiementing and waiting for more patches.
